We are hiring a Safety Coordinator in our Conyers, GA manufacturing facility. At Tempur Sealy, ensuring a safe working environment for the associates and managers within our manufacturing sites is our number one priority. The Safety Coordinator provides technical support and tactical execution in the implementation of Tempur Sealy’s Health and Safety programs within our sites.

What You’ll Do:

  • Serve as designated Safety Coordinator for the assigned manufacturing site.
  • Assist the site leadership in the coordination and implementation of the Tempur Sealy Safety Program as directed by site leadership and the Regional Safety Manager.
  • Serve as a safety role model and be an inspiration to others.
  • Conduct training and coach associates on observed work habits in support of this effort.
  • Support management’s efforts to ensure compliance with corporate Safety Program expectations and applicable federal and state law.
  • Identify and be part of the team that will address compliance issues, safety risks and improvement opportunities through the completion of daily, weekly and monthly audits.
  • Partner and coach leadership on the incident investigation process.
  • Maintain accurate daily, weekly and monthly metrics reporting to onsite management teams and corporate based reporting systems.
  • Maintain required paperwork to comply with Tempur Sealy standards.
  • Provide (or facilitate access to) immediate aid for associates, visitors, vendors, or guests that need assistance, or medical attention.
  • Perform safety observations (FSI) & audits as required by the Regional Safety Manager and TSI Safety Policies.
  • Conduct monthly ergonomic assessments and suggest improvements to processes and workstation design to reduce ergonomic risk.
  • Conduct new employee safety orientation/training and annual re-certification.
  • Conduct on-site authorized training with plant employees as required.
  • Develop safety related information for monthly All Employee meeting.
  • Actively facilitate monthly Associate Safety Committee.
  • Participation in weekly safety calls for weekly staffing meetings held by corporate EHS.
  • Identify opportunities and suggest actions to improve site recycling efforts and to reduce energy usage.

What You’ll Need:

Basic Qualifications:

  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office including Word, Excel.
  • Proficiency in keyboarding, web search, using online programs.
  • Strong communication and leadership skills; self-driven.
  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Able to maintain current First aid and CPR certificates.
  • Existing knowledge or willingness to learn and administer emergency response.
  • Able to maintain confidentiality in matters involving security and/or personnel issues.
  • Ability to successfully complete and maintain OSHA 30-hour certification.
  • Strong influence, teamwork, analysis, judgment, customer focus skills and the ability to train groups of associates.
  • Ability and success with analyzing incident data and creating meaningful actions with lasting results.
  • Ability to work independently.

Preferred Qualifications & Skills:

  • Basic understanding of OSHA regulations specifically 29 CFR 1910.
  • Understanding of Worker’s Compensation case management, OSHA recordability guidelines and RTW processes.
  • Microsoft PowerPoint knowledge.
  • Some college or relevant experience preferably in a safety related or technical field.
